WebAug 28, 2024 · If you’re unsure of what number to use, contact the Social Security Administration office at 1-800-772-1213 (toll-free). Once the withholding starts, it will stay in effect until either you stop it or the payments stop. If you want to stop the withholding or change the amount, you simply fill out another Form W-4V. Social Security: Withholding isn't required on Social Security payments, but a portion of your benefits may be taxable, depending on your income. You can set up or change your withholding by submitting Form W-4V to the Social Security Administration.

WebIf you are already receiving benefits or if you want to change or stop your withholding, you'll need a Form W-4V from the Internal Revenue Service (IRS).
